Stephen Cannavale Obituary

We are sad to announce that on March 9, 2018 we had to say goodbye to Stephen Cannavale (Caldwell, New Jersey), born in Jersey City, New Jersey. He is survived by: his wife Lucy Cannavale (Viganola); his children, Stephen, Corinne, Emily and Jonathan; his father Frank Cannavale; his siblings, Cerene, Frank (Cheryl) and Miriam; his parents-in-law, Vincent Viganola and Nancy Viganola; and his siblings-in-law, Maria Romond (Michael), Nancy DiPinto (Frenchie), Anthony (Claudia) and Frankie. He is also survived by many nieces, nephews, and friends.
